[QUOTE="amd599, post: 251723, member: 70019"] [b]More hotkeys with HD Player Plug-in[/b] --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Well, here's what I did.....I realized that your HD_Starter.exe is just a compiled AutoHotKey so I made another AutoHotKey .exe file which basily said: "If the CyberLink PowerDVD Window is active then when I press +3 (shift + 3 = # -- so it's mapped to the # on my MCE remote) then send ctrl+o" THen I just made that load on startup and it seemed to work well. However I am having a few weird instances of things such as the "Open Files from Hard Drive" will lose focus like if a mouse click was initiated in the background so it loses focus and then it doesn't work again. Maybe you can come up with some more elegant so that its always onfocus of the CyberLink PowerDVD software until you press the back button (esc) which will then close down PowerDVD and bring you back to media portal. Also, I am using all of this with the SafeSpin 1080 skin, i'm not even sure if your solution is 100% supported in that skin. Anyway, if it can all be bundled into HD_Starter.exe, even better. In-fact...is there anyway that you can supply the source code of HD_Starter.exe, the AutoHotKey code I guess it would be? I'd like to re-map a few things to make it easier on me.
